This paper proposes a recommendation method considering users' time series contexts which are situations that have occurred/will occur in the past/future. There are some recommendation methods that provide information suitable for users' action patterns as the recommendation methods considering them. These methods provide information referring to the other users that have a similar action pattern to that of an active user. However, since a user's action pattern changes depending on the user's contexts, the methods need to refer to the other users' action patterns related to the current user's contexts. In this paper, we propose a recommendation method considering the user's time series contexts considering that the user's action pattern changes depending on the user's contexts. Copyright 2009 ACM.

A new features based algorithm for face recognition is proposed. The algorithm is based on locating features on faces and finding the correspondence of these features between faces using an algorithm which is adopted from the works of Yasein and Agathoklis. The algorithm is using feature extraction through filtering with Mexican-hat wavelets and detection of correspondence of the feature points through comparison of Zernike moments. The transformation of the feature points between images is obtained using an iterative weighted least-squares algorithm which allows to eliminate outliers. The face recognition is based on the residual error between the feature points after transformation. The performance of the proposed method is evaluated using experiments with a face database and compared against existing techniques for face recognition. The results of experiments with varying pose and illumination conditions show that the proposed method performs well compared to existing feature based face recognition techniques.

The architecture of designed intrusion detection system is based on two layer hybrid model for event detection. System function is based on analysis parts of network flow in a real communication and offers processing of this data in a real time. The core of the first layer are detection sensors, which offer base processing based on statistical methods with direct interconnection to countermeasure module. Performance and accuracy of designed system is secured with central distributed processing, in which is used detection based on particular event description, which foregoing intrusion. This paper introduces a method for better communication between collaborating engineers and between engineer and entity generation processes at the definition of products in modeling systems. The authors recognized the importance of correct human-computer- human communication by using of product model as a special medium for engineers. In order to establish a product model that is appropriate for this purpose, they integrated all influencing effects on a product in an influencing space. In order to record content of influencing by engineers and other influencing persons, authorities, etc., the currently prevailing information based product model is completed by representation of information content. This paper emphasizes some relevant issues of information content. Definition of this contents starts from modeling of human intent. Intent model is consists of information about the owner of an intent, characteristics of that intent, and representation of content of intent in some form of knowledge. Information content is organized in the interconnected intent, behavior, and decision spaces. In a hierarchical system, intent space is at the highest and decision space is at the lowest level hierarchy assuring human intent based automation of decision making on engineering object in an improved product model.

E-Learning makes it possible for learners to study at any time. With the improvement of ubiquitous technologies and corresponding devices, learners can conduct their learning activities without any limitations from the environment. Instructors can utilize various kinds of resources to create more plentiful learning materials for learners. In this situation, instructors or learners have to spend more time on collecting relevant resources for a specific purpose. In our previous works, we utilized the geographical information and RFID (Radio Frequency Identification) to develop an outdoor adventure game to support learning procedures. In this paper, we go further to propose and develop a resource retrieval mechanism to assist learners in collecting relevant learning resources. This mechanism can be regarded as a search procedure. We aim at providing search results in the order of relevant degree based on learners' current geographical information. It can make resource retrieval more efficient in ubiquitous learning environments.
